Factors to Consider When Choosing Baby Humidifier Deals

When you compare baby humidifier deals, check tank capacity so you know how often you’ll refill it. You should also look at noise levels, safety features, room coverage, and how easy it is to clean. These factors help you pick a humidifier that fits your nursery and your routine.
Tank Capacity
Tank capacity is one of the biggest factors in how well a baby humidifier fits your space, since larger tanks usually run longer and handle bigger rooms with less refilling. You’ll usually see tanks from 1.5 to 3 liters, and that size can change runtime from about 12 to 30 hours, depending on the setting. If you want coverage for rooms up to 320 square feet, a larger tank often makes sense. A 2.5-liter model can give you a practical middle ground, offering enough output for small to medium rooms without feeling bulky. Also, look for a top-fill design so you can refill and clean it more easily. Make sure the tank is BPA-free, too, for safer use around your baby.
Noise Levels
Noise matters a lot when you’re choosing a baby humidifier deal, because a unit that runs at 26–28 dB can stay quiet enough to avoid disturbing sleep. You should check the decibel rating before you buy, since louder machines can wake your baby or make it harder to settle down. Many baby-friendly humidifiers focus on whisper-quiet operation, which helps you keep the nursery calm at night. Low-noise models also let you ease coughing and congestion without adding extra background sound. If you want a peaceful bedroom, compare the specs and choose a humidifier built for quiet performance. That way, you support better rest and avoid turning a helpful appliance into a nighttime distraction.
Safety Features
Quiet operation is only part of the picture; safety features matter just as much when you’re choosing a baby humidifier deal. You should look for automatic shut-off, so the unit powers down when the water runs low or you remove the tank. That helps prevent overheating and reduces hazards. Pick a humidifier made with BPA-free materials, because you don’t want chemicals near your baby. Indicator lights are useful too; they tell you when it’s time to refill, so you can keep humidity steady without guessing. Check that the design feels sturdy and resists spills or leaks. A robust build gives you more peace of mind and helps keep your baby’s space safer every day.
Room Coverage
When you’re choosing a baby humidifier deal, match the unit’s room coverage to the space you need to humidify, since most models are designed for about 250 to 320 square feet and work well in nurseries or small to medium bedrooms. If you buy a unit that’s too small, it won’t keep humidity steady; if it’s too large, you may waste money. Look for a tank of 2.5 liters or more if you want longer runtime and fewer refills. Adjustable mist output and a 360-degree nozzle help you direct moisture where your baby sleeps, improving coverage. Ultrasonic models stay quiet, so they won’t disturb naps while still supporting healthy humidity. Pick the square footage that matches your room for the best comfort and breathing support.
Ease Of Cleaning
After you’ve matched the humidifier’s coverage to your nursery, make cleanup just as important. You’ll use the unit far longer if you can wash it quickly and thoroughly. Choose a model with a wide tank opening so you can reach inside easily, rinse away mineral deposits, and refill without spills. A top-fill design can save you time because you don’t have to remove the whole tank. Look for detachable parts too; they let you clean each section well instead of guessing at hidden buildup. Weekly cleaning should feel manageable, so check that the manufacturer recommends it. Smooth interiors and included cleaning brushes also help you scrub less and maintain better hygiene. When maintenance is simple, you’re more likely to keep the humidifier performing well and your baby’s air fresh.

Frequently Asked Questions
How Often Should I Clean a Baby Humidifier?
You should clean your baby humidifier daily, emptying and drying it, then disinfect it weekly. Clean it sooner if you notice slime, odor, or mineral buildup, so you keep your baby’s air safe and healthy.
Can Essential Oils Be Used in Baby Humidifiers?
No, you shouldn’t use essential oils in baby humidifiers; they can irritate tiny lungs. Think of your child’s air as a delicate garden—keep it plain, clean, and moist. Use water only and follow the manufacturer’s guidance.
What Humidity Level Is Best for a Nursery?
You should keep your nursery humidity between 40% and 50% to help your baby breathe comfortably and reduce dryness. Use a hygrometer, and don’t let moisture climb too high, because excess humidity can encourage mold growth.
Are Warm Mist Humidifiers Safe for Babies?
Yes, warm mist humidifiers can be safe for babies, but you’ve got to place them where your child can’t reach them, since hot water and steam can burn. You’ll usually choose cool mist instead.
How Loud Are Baby Humidifiers at Night?
You’ll usually hear a soft hum, often around 20 to 40 decibels, so it’s quiet enough for sleep. You can choose ultrasonic models for less noise, but you should avoid rattling tanks.
